The tracker field "subscription" should include an option to automatically send a notification message to them item autor (and "watchers" of the item, maybe?)
Because subscription field is very useful also in letting people show interest in whatever you offered or requested in a tracker, and might be an easy way to let users get in contact related to that offer or demand... etc.

Add a user field as owner of the tracker item, and set it to receive email notifications of changes to the tracker items they are owners of. This has nothing to do with this specific field "subscription", but might server for the basic purpose in generic use cases.
Maybe that is enough. That's why I set it as "partially solved", and keep it as pending, in case anyone uses this field and lacks this feature for their use cases. Personally I never used this feature because of lacking such feature (or emailing owner when maximum seats at subscribed, etc)
